What Goes Into Preparing Outdoor Surfaces

Exterior painting starts with scraping off loose paint, sanding rough edges, and pressure washing the surfaces to remove dirt, mold, and chalky residue. In Texarkana, where humidity encourages mildew growth and sun exposure breaks down older coatings, this prep work determines how long the new paint will last. Cracks in wood trim are filled, and bare spots are primed before the topcoat is applied.

How long does exterior painting take?
Most single-story homes take three to five days, depending on size and the amount of trim work. Two-story homes or properties with extensive prep needs may take up to a week.
What happens if it rains during the project?
You will see the schedule adjusted to avoid painting in wet conditions. Paint needs dry surfaces and low humidity to cure properly, so work pauses if rain is forecast within 24 hours of application.
When should I repaint my exterior?
You should repaint when you see chalking, cracking, or peeling on siding or trim, or when the color has faded noticeably. Most exterior finishes in Texarkana last five to ten years depending on sun exposure and surface type.
Why does paint fail faster on some parts of the house?
South and west-facing walls receive more direct sun and heat, which breaks down paint faster. Trim near the ground stays wetter longer and may peel sooner if moisture gets trapped underneath.
